Its achievement was recorded officially by representatives of the Book. The cat from the English city of Huntingdon, County of Cambridgeshire, broke a world record on the loudest purring. As writes Daily Star, the representative of the Guinness Book of Records confirmed that the 14-year-old domestic cat by nickname Bella purrs with loudness 54,6 decibels — it louder, than a sound of boiling of water in a teapot. The mistress of a cat of Spink Nicole admitted: she did not doubt at all that Bella will break a record: the cat purrs so loudly that the sound made by it sometimes even muffles the TV in the room.
